The structure of intermittent operation ball mill is simple. It is one of the most widely used electric porcelain and ceramic industry. This ball mill has a body which is welded or riveted together with steel plates. Supported by two bearings. The mill body is driven by a separate motor through a reducer, a friction coupling, a transmission gear and a large gear. The purpose of using the friction coupling is to prevent the motor from overload when the mill is started. When this mill is used in the electric porcelain industry, it is generally operated by wet method, and the middle part of the mill is provided with feeding port (or manhole), feeding and discharging as well as workers' internal maintenance. Each time a batch is finely mixed, the mill is stopped, the lid of the feed port is opened, and a short tube with small holes is installed to prevent the body grinding body from being discharged along with the slurry. Then turn the carcass so that the discharge port is facing the ground so that the inside slurry can flow out. The grinding body is lined with porcelain or silicon lining board. The abrasive body is also made of porcelain or silicon. Because porcelain abrasive body and liner are easy to wear, in order to meet the special requirements of electric porcelain technology, we can use the same abrasive body and aluminum liner with finely ground material. Spherical abrasive bodies made of high alumina, zirconia and other materials can be used in the preparation of special slurry. These materials are heavy (up to 3.5) and hard, so it is appropriate to use them to make grinding bodies, which not only contribute to the production capacity of ball mills with high intermittent operation of ball mills, but also lower consumption of grinding bodies.

The shape of the lining plates of the mill varies according to the position in which they are installed inside the carcass. For the same type of mill, there should not be too many types of lining plates, so as not to complicate the manufacture of lining plates. When porcelain pledges line board is made, it is to shape first hind calcining, the line board of granite is used artificially ponder and become. The length and width of the linings depend on the size of the feeding port on the mill body, so that the linings can be easily loaded or removed from the feeding port. The thickness of the lining plate is determined by the diameter of the mill body, about 100~150mm. Linings are generally used fast hard cement gelation in the body of the shell, linings between the seams should be the narrower the better.

The structure of conical ball mill is composed of three parts: the conical part whose vertex Angle is about 120°, the circular part whose length is 0.25~0.8 times of diameter, and the conical part whose vertex Angle is 60~80°. After the material enters the grinding body through the hollow pivot from the feeder and is acted by the grinding body in the body, the finely ground material is discharged by the hollow pivot of discharging material.
